Nancy Hurd Obituary

Nancy Lee Hurd
August 9, 1935 - July 20, 2022
Charlotte, North Carolina - Nancy Lee Hurd (Age 86) went to be with the Lord peacefully on Wednesday July 20th, 2022, in the loving arms of her four living children. Nancy was born outside of Detroit, Michigan on August 9th, 1935. Nancy grew up in Poughkeepsie, NY and was baptized at First Presbyterian Church in Poughkeepsie on April 2nd, 1950. She graduated from Wappinger Falls High school where she was a cheerleader and played field hockey. She later attended Syracuse University and then after a move to Boston, MA, attended Lasell University. Nancy married Paul Hurd and they became the proud parents to five children. She devoted her life to God, family, friends and church involvement. As she navigated life's many obstacles and challenges she never wavered in her faith and dedicated her time to others, including her mother who she cared for in her home for 17 years. Nancy worked at IBM for 17 years, Calvary Church Counseling Center and Joni and Friends. She loved Calvary Church and was a member for over 35 years, was involved in many Bible studies, sang in the choir, served on the Martha Ministry team and became a Griefshare Counselor where she was able to share her life's journey with others, providing comfort and support. Nancy was preceded in death by her son, Bob, siblings Betty and Jim, and mother Edna. She is survived by her remaining children Pam Wigfield (Greg), Cindy Murdock (Greg), Bill Hurd (Robin) and Ken Hurd (Sandra). In addition to her many great grandchildren, Nancy is survived by her nine grandchildren: Rachel Waldron, Ryan Wigfield, Robert Wigfield, Kyle, Laura, Kelly and Meredith Murdock, Grant Hurd, and Ashleigh Hurd. She is also survived by her sister Barbara Issac, and sister-in-law Donna McHale and many nieces and nephews.
